Grand Guitar Tsunami Relief Benefit Gig
Grand Guitar Tsunami Relief Benefit Gig from Aceh Support Group Friday Feb 4th 7pm Blue Note Bar, 191-195 Cuba Street Cost: $5 enquiries to John asg@eclectic.org.nz
Acoustic performances by Jessie and Urs (ace clarinet and guitar strumming duo) Cameron Burnell (songs of struggle, past and present), Jonah (acoustic guitar with humour and love), Don Franks (celebrated singer and social commentator).
All proceeds to Aceh Support Group Tsunami Relief Donations going to IDEP www.idepfoundation.org A grassroots NGO working in Acheh right now For more details on IDEP go to http://spaces.msn.com/members/susijohnston/PersonalSpace.aspx?_c=
